Composites • Carbon fibre • Sports equipment • Excellent strength to weight ratio • Very expensive, only available in black, hard to recycle • Glass reinforced plastics (GRP) • Vehicle bodies • Excellent strength to weight ratio • Expensive, high quality mould needed • Medium density fibreboard (MDF) • Flat pack furniture • Consistent in all directions • Heavier, dulls blades quicker

Modern materials and products • Liquid crystal displays (LCDs) • Digital watches and TV’s • Goes dark when a voltage applied • In TV’s has RGB layers • Phosphorescent pigments • “Glow in the dark” • Absorb energy from light and stores • Releases slowly at night • Electroluminescent (E.L.) lighting • Used for LCD backlighting and advertisements • Converts electrical energy into light • Waterproof and highly visible

Smart Materials • Thermochromic liquid crystals/film • Forehead thermometers • Reacts to temperature • Piezoelectric crystals • Converts movement into electricity and back • Used in inkjet printers to push out ink • Smart ink • Also known as electronic ink (or e-ink) • Kindle • Displays only use energy when the display is refreshed • Radio frequency identification (RFID) • A method of identification • Uses tags to store and track data • Used in libraries, factories etc
